ABSTRACT:
A seismic streamer and a method for positioning a group of hydrophones in a seismic streamer. The hydrophones in a group are spaced irregularly along the length of the streamer to reduce the influence of bulge-wave noise and flow noise on the hydrophone group response. The irregular spacing may be produced as pseudorandom deviations of the actual positions of the hydrophones from a nominal uniform spacing of hydrophones.
